Here in Lynnwood, WA, we’re no strangers to heavy winter rains and snowmelt that can turn our gutters into overflowing water reservoirs. Water damage from clogged gutters can be a homeowner’s worst nightmare, especially with the hidden risks of mold growth and structural damage. So, what can you do to prevent this from happening to your property? Inspect your gutters regularly. Check for sagging or loose gutters. Make sure downspout extensions direct water at least 3-4 feet away from your foundation.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Heavy rainfall or snowmelt causes water to overflow from your gutters. Yes No DIY can be a quick and easy fix, especially if you catch the issue early.
Water damage has already occurred, and you’re unsure how to proceed. No Yes A professional team can assess the damage and develop a customized plan to restore your home.
You’re not sure if you can handle the job safely and efficiently. No Yes A professional team has the equipment and expertise to handle the job quickly and safely.
You’re concerned about the potential health risks associated with water damage. No Yes A professional team can identify and address any health risks associated with water damage.
You’re on a tight budget and need to save money. Yes No DIY can be a cost-effective solution, especially if you catch the issue early.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ost in Lynnwood, WA

The cost of Gutter Overflow Water Removal services in Lynnwood,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Inspection and Maintenance $100 – $500 Frequency of inspection, type of maintenance needed
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, type of materials or structures affected
Disinfecting and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Type of materials or structures affected, level of contamination
Equipment Rental and Usage $100 – $500 Type of equipment needed, usage time
